Transaction 52ad578bf88d10d97c76a7dabf7aebddf1b4c63751bfb6c0f7a01c98f2035675

1 Input
2 Outputs
  • 52ad578bf88d10d97c76a7dabf7aebddf1b4c63751bfb6c0f7a01c98f2035675:0
  • value  6794697
    address  1E2NNsovjonXUKTRodZGB7P1Chefk4aALf
  • 52ad578bf88d10d97c76a7dabf7aebddf1b4c63751bfb6c0f7a01c98f2035675:1
  • value  110271561
    address  13MeBuX8qw1rZ1Aydb2NqAS9rifQnHwQx4